White jade tiger amulet, Western Han dynasty

Description.

Amulet of white jade, with reddish-golden spots. The amulet is divided into two parts that fit together in the middle with a central Chinese character as part and counterpart. The outer part of each has the volume and shape of a tiger, which shows its teeth and front claws. The tails are tucked up in a spiral shape. On the back and side are engraved characters that acquire meaning when the pieces are put together: "杜陽左一 杜陽泰守維護第一".

During the Han dynasty a sculptural tradition emerged with greater interest in the depiction of fabulous animals and beasts in durable materials such as jade. In this case it is a type of talisman in the form of a tiger for sending messages between troops and generals. 

Overall size: 5 x 1.9 x 9 cm; Weight: 119 g
